"Physician Money Mistakes with Varun Verma MD" is a podcast episode where Varun Verma talks about common financial mistakes made by physicians. He shares his personal experiences and provides insights on topics such as maximizing investments in retirement accounts, student loan repayment strategies, investing in unfamiliar areas, creating a budget, utilizing technology tools for financial planning, and the importance of having a written financial plan.

Joseph Saveika, MD, is the Medical Director of Norman Regional's Inpatient Rehabilitation Center. Dr. Saveika earned his medical degree from Eastern Virginia Medical School. Dr. Saveika was inspired to become a physician after volunteering at a hospital where he lived. He was an engineer at the time, but wanted more human interaction. One of the physicians at the hospital suggested he apply to medical school. Dr. Saveika moved to Oklahoma from Norfolk, Virginia.
